The human claustrum is a bilateral, thin, irregularly shaped gray matter structure located between the striatum and insula. While previous research demonstrated the effect of distinct medical conditions, such as prematurity, schizophrenia, and Alzheimer’s disease, on claustrum function and structure, it is poorly understood how non-pathologic biological conditions effect the claustrum.
